Neoral (SYE-kloe-spor-een) belongs to the group of medicines known as immunosuppressive agents. It is used to reduce the body's natural immunity in patients who receive organ (for example, kidney, liver, and heart) transplants. When a patient receives an organ transplant, the body's white blood cells will try to get rid of (reject) the transplanted organ. Neoral works by preventing the white blood cells from doing this. Neoral also is used to treat severe cases of psoriasis and rheumatoid arthritis. Neoral may also be used for other conditions, as determined by your doctor. Neoral is a very strong medicine. It may cause side effects that could be very serious, such as high blood pressure and kidney and liver problems. It may also reduce the body's ability to fight infections. You and your doctor should talk about the good Neoral will do as well as the risks of using it.

Neoral comes as a capsule and liquid to take by mouth. Your doctor will prescribe the correct dosing schedule for you. Take your doses at the same time each day. Follow the directions on your prescription label carefully, and ask your doctor or pharmacist to explain any part you do not understand. You will probably have to take Neoral for a long time, possibly for the rest of your life. Take Neoral exactly as directed. Do not take more or less of it or take it more often than prescribed by your doctor. The oral liquid comes with a special syringe with markings for measuring the dose. Ask your pharmacist to show you how to use it, and tell the pharmacist if you have difficulty reading these markings. Remove the protective cover from the syringe and carefully measure the dose. Place the dose in a glass container (be sure to use glass) and dilute it with milk, chocolate milk, or orange juice (preferably at room temperature). Stir the mixture well and drink it immediately. Do not allow it to stand. After taking the dose, rinse the glass with a second portion of just the beverage and drink it to be sure that you receive the entire dose. Dry the outside of the syringe with a clean towel after each use and replace the protective cover. Do not rinse the syringe with water. Brand names: - Cyclosporine - Neoral - Sandimmune - SangCya |
